P2092
A Camshaft Position Actuator Control Circuit Low (Bank 2)
The intake (A) camshaft phaser solenoid drive line on bank 2 is stuck low — short to ground or stuck-low driver. Variable-valve timing on intake bank 2 cannot be modulated.

Possible causes
- Short to ground in solenoid drive line high
- Solenoid winding shorted internally medium
- Connector pins corroded - high contact resistance low
Symptoms
- Check engine light on
- Power loss especially in mid-rpm range
- Possible rough idle or stalling
- Increased fuel consumption
